2.4 Installation Procedure
1. Read this manual thoroughly before Installing, Operating, or Maintaining this lift.
2. Site Evaluation and Lift Location
A. Always use an architect's plan when provided. Before unpacking the lift entirely, determine if the
site is adequate for the lift model being installed see Figures 1 & 2 for typical bay layout and ceiling
height requirements. It is recommended to have 170" (14-2") minimal celling height.
B. Determine which side will be the approach side.
C. Now determine which side you prefer the power unit to be located on. The MAIN column has the
power-unit mounting bracket attached to the side
THE POWER UNIT COLUMN CAN BE LOCATED ON EITHER SIDE. IT IS HELPFUL TO TRY
AND LOCATE THE POWER SIDE ON THE PASSENGER SIDE OF THE VEHICLE WHEN
LOADED ON THE LIFT, IN ORDER TO SAVE STEPS DURING OPERATION.
D. Once a location is determined, use a carpenter's chalk line to layout a grid for the column's
locations.
E. After the post locations are marked, use a chalk or crayon to make an outline of the posts on the
floor at each location using the post base plates as a template.
F. Double check all dimensions and make sure that the layout is perfectly square.
DO NOT USE THESE LINES TO POSITION THE COLUMNS, FOLLOW THE INSTRUCTIONS IN
THIS MANUAL.
3. Unpack the Lift
A. Remove the lifting arms, lifting pads, height adapters, hardware box, hoses, covers, power
unit box, column extensions and overhead beam from packaging.
B. Save all packing hardware, as these components may be required to complete the installation.
C. Remove the packing bolts from brackets, which hold the two columns together.
D. Remove the upper column. Do not stand the columns up now but lay the columns with their
backs on the floor.
4. Attach Uprights / Column Extensions
A. Connect column uprights / extensions to each column using M10 bolts, washers and nuts.
DUE TO HEAVY WEIGHT OF COLUMN ASSEMBLY, IT IS HIGHLY RECOMMENDED TO USE A
HOIST OR FORKLIFT TO ASSIST IN STANDING THE COLUMNS TO AN UPRIGHT POSTION.
